1. Network Connectivity Issues

Network connectivity represents a fundamental requirement for accessing electronic mail. Without a stable and functional network connection, the email client is unable to communicate with the mail server, resulting in the inability to retrieve or send messages. Diagnosing network-related disruptions is a crucial first step in resolving electronic mail access problems.

  • Intermittent Internet Access

    Unstable or fluctuating internet connectivity can cause temporary disruptions in email access. Even brief losses of connection can interrupt the download of new messages or prevent the sending of outgoing mail. For example, a weak Wi-Fi signal or temporary outage from an internet service provider can prevent email from loading.

  • Firewall Restrictions

    Firewall software, designed to protect systems from unauthorized access, can sometimes inadvertently block legitimate email traffic. Misconfigured firewall rules may prevent the email client from connecting to the mail server on the required ports (e.g., SMTP, IMAP, POP3). Such a restriction effectively cuts off communication between the email client and the service, preventing email retrieval.

  • DNS Resolution Problems

    The Domain Name System (DNS) translates domain names (e.g., mail.example.com) into IP addresses. If the DNS server is unavailable or unable to resolve the email server’s domain name, the email client will be unable to locate the server. This results in an error preventing email retrieval, as the client cannot establish the necessary connection.

  • VPN Interference

    While Virtual Private Networks (VPNs) enhance security, they can sometimes interfere with email access. VPNs reroute internet traffic through different servers, and if the VPN server experiences issues or has incompatible settings, email access can be disrupted. Additionally, some email providers may block traffic originating from known VPN server IP addresses for security reasons.

These network connectivity factors directly impact the ability to access electronic mail. Identifying and resolving connectivity issues, whether they originate from intermittent internet access, firewall restrictions, DNS resolution problems, or VPN interference, is essential to restoring the flow of electronic communication.

2. Incorrect Account Settings

Incorrect account settings represent a primary impediment to accessing electronic mail. Accurate configuration of email client software is essential for establishing a connection to the mail server. Errors in these settings prevent the proper exchange of data, effectively blocking access to electronic correspondence. Several specific settings are particularly critical.

  • Incorrect Username or Password

    The username and password serve as the primary authentication credentials for accessing an email account. Entry of an incorrect username or password will prevent the email server from granting access. This can result from simple typing errors, password changes not reflected in the email client settings, or account lockouts due to multiple failed login attempts. For example, a user who recently updated their email password on the web interface, but failed to update it on their phone’s email app, will be unable to retrieve messages via their phone.

  • Incorrect Server Settings (IMAP/POP3/SMTP)

    Email clients rely on specific server settings to connect to the mail server. These include the incoming mail server (IMAP or POP3), the outgoing mail server (SMTP), and the associated port numbers. Incorrect server addresses, port numbers, or security protocol settings (SSL/TLS) will prevent successful connection. For example, if a user manually configures their email account and enters the wrong IMAP server address, the email client will be unable to retrieve new messages. Similarly, an incorrect SMTP server setting would prevent the sending of emails.

  • Authentication Method Mismatch

    Email servers often require specific authentication methods, such as standard password authentication or more secure methods like OAuth. If the email client is configured to use an authentication method not supported by the server or if the configuration is incorrect, access will be denied. A common example is when a user attempts to use standard password authentication on a Gmail account without enabling “less secure app access” or configuring an app password, leading to access failure.

  • Incorrect Security Protocol Settings (SSL/TLS)

    Secure Sockets Layer (SSL) and Transport Layer Security (TLS) protocols encrypt email traffic for enhanced security. Incorrect configuration of these protocols, such as selecting an unsupported version or failing to enable SSL/TLS when required by the server, can prevent successful connection. An example would be an older email client attempting to connect to a server requiring TLS 1.2 without having that protocol enabled. The connection will fail, and the user will be unable to access their email.

These issues stemming from incorrect account settings collectively represent a significant cause of electronic mail access problems. Resolving these problems involves careful verification and correction of each setting within the email client, ensuring they align with the requirements of the email service provider. Failure to do so can result in continued inability to retrieve or send electronic correspondence.

3. Email server downtime

Email server downtime directly correlates with the inability to access electronic correspondence. When the server responsible for storing and transmitting email messages becomes unavailable due to maintenance, technical failures, or unforeseen circumstances, users are effectively locked out of their accounts. This represents a fundamental cause of access issues, as the server provides the necessary infrastructure for email operations. The consequence of server downtime is that email clients, regardless of their individual settings or configurations, cannot establish a connection to retrieve or send messages. This is because the system required to process these requests is temporarily non-operational.

The impact of email server downtime varies based on the scale and duration of the outage. A brief period of maintenance, often scheduled during off-peak hours, might cause only minor inconvenience. However, prolonged or unscheduled downtime can severely disrupt business operations and personal communication. For instance, during a critical server failure, employees may be unable to access essential information or communicate with clients, leading to missed deadlines and impaired productivity. Similarly, individuals relying on email for important notifications or updates will be unable to receive timely information. The extent of the disruption underscores the critical role of email servers in modern communication infrastructure.

Understanding email server downtime as a source of access problems is crucial for effective troubleshooting. When encountering difficulties in opening electronic mail, it is essential to consider the possibility of server unavailability. Service providers typically provide notifications regarding planned maintenance; however, unexpected outages may occur without warning. Checking the service provider’s status page or contacting their support channels can help determine if the problem stems from server downtime. If the issue is server-related, the only recourse is to await the restoration of service. Recognizing this possibility prevents unproductive troubleshooting efforts focused on local settings or software configurations, streamlining the resolution process and minimizing frustration.

4. Software Version Incompatibility

Software version incompatibility represents a significant cause of electronic mail access issues. Email clients and servers operate under specific protocols and standards that evolve over time. When the software versions of the client and server are not compatible, communication breakdowns occur, effectively preventing access to electronic correspondence. This incompatibility manifests as an inability to authenticate, retrieve messages, or properly display email content. The failure stems from the differing capabilities or support for security protocols, data formats, or communication methods between the versions.

The impact of software version incompatibility is broad. For instance, an outdated email client may lack the necessary support for modern encryption methods like TLS 1.3, which a server mandates for security. In this scenario, the email client cannot establish a secure connection, leading to authentication failures and an inability to retrieve messages. Similarly, a server running older software might not support newer data formats employed by updated email clients, leading to display errors or message corruption. This issue is amplified when organizations fail to maintain or update their email infrastructure, creating compatibility gaps with the increasingly advanced software used by clients.

Understanding software version incompatibility is crucial for diagnosing and resolving electronic mail access problems. When encountering issues, verifying that both the email client and server meet the minimum version requirements is essential. Upgrading the software to compatible versions typically resolves the problem. However, legacy systems or older devices may lack upgrade options, necessitating alternative solutions like using a different email client or configuring less secure settings (if permissible). Identifying and addressing version mismatches ensures smooth communication between email clients and servers, restoring the ability to access electronic correspondence.

5. Insufficient storage capacity

Insufficient storage capacity directly impedes the ability to access electronic mail. Email systems operate on the principle of storing messages on a server or within local client storage. When the allocated storage space is exhausted, the system can no longer accommodate new incoming messages, effectively preventing their retrieval. Additionally, attempting to open existing emails might also fail if the system is unable to allocate temporary space for processing the message’s content. This limitation represents a critical component of access problems, as it directly restricts the user’s ability to interact with electronic correspondence. A user, for example, may continue to receive notifications of incoming messages, but upon attempting to open them, receives an error message indicating insufficient space.

The importance of adequate storage is further highlighted when considering email clients that synchronize data between the server and local devices. If local storage is full, the client may be unable to download new messages, even if space remains available on the server. This can occur in mobile devices with limited storage or in desktop clients with large archives and limited disk space. Regularly archiving or deleting unnecessary emails mitigates this risk. Furthermore, many email providers offer options to increase storage capacity, either for free or through paid subscription plans. Understanding the relationship between storage limits and access is paramount for proactive management and avoidance of email retrieval issues.

Addressing storage capacity limitations necessitates regular monitoring and management of email data. Deleting large attachments, archiving older messages to external storage, and increasing storage quotas are all viable strategies for ensuring uninterrupted access to electronic correspondence. Failure to address this issue will invariably lead to continued access problems, missed communications, and potentially significant disruptions in both personal and professional contexts.

6. Security software interference

Security software interference represents a notable impediment to accessing electronic mail, often resulting in a users inability to open messages. This phenomenon occurs when security applications, such as antivirus programs, firewalls, or anti-spam filters, mistakenly identify legitimate email traffic as malicious and subsequently block or quarantine it. Such actions prevent the user from receiving, viewing, or interacting with their electronic correspondence. The core issue lies in the overly aggressive filtering or misidentification of email content, links, or attachments, triggering security protocols that interrupt the normal flow of communication. For example, an antivirus program might flag an email containing a specific file type as a potential threat and prevent the user from opening the message, even if the file is safe.

The impact of security software interference is significant because it disrupts critical communication channels. Essential business correspondence, time-sensitive notifications, and important personal messages can be blocked, leading to missed deadlines, broken communication, and potential data loss. Furthermore, diagnosing security software interference can be challenging, as the symptoms often mimic other email-related problems. A user might suspect network issues or server downtime when the actual cause is a misconfigured security application blocking email traffic. The practical significance of understanding this connection lies in the ability to accurately identify the root cause of email access issues and implement appropriate solutions, such as adjusting security software settings or whitelisting specific email addresses or domains. Without this understanding, troubleshooting becomes inefficient and potentially ineffective.

In conclusion, security software interference represents a critical component in understanding why individuals cannot open their emails. It underscores the delicate balance between security and accessibility in electronic communication. By recognizing the potential for security software to inadvertently block legitimate email traffic, users and administrators can implement strategies to mitigate interference while maintaining essential security protections, thereby ensuring reliable and consistent access to electronic correspondence. The challenge lies in fine-tuning security software configurations to minimize false positives and ensure the seamless delivery of legitimate emails.

7. Compromised Password

A compromised password represents a significant security vulnerability that can directly lead to an inability to access electronic mail. The unauthorized disclosure or theft of login credentials renders the legitimate user unable to access their account due to a change in password by the unauthorized party. This issue highlights the critical role of secure password management in maintaining access to email accounts.

  • Unauthorized Account Access

    When a password is compromised, malicious actors can gain unauthorized access to the email account. This access allows them to change the password, effectively locking out the legitimate user. Upon attempting to log in with the original password, the user will encounter an error message, indicating an invalid username or password. The inability to access the account stems directly from the unauthorized alteration of access credentials.

  • Security Protocol Triggers

    Many email providers implement security protocols that detect suspicious login activity. If a password is used from an unusual location or device, the provider may temporarily suspend access to the account as a precautionary measure. This action, while intended to protect the account, prevents the legitimate user from accessing their email until they verify their identity and regain control of the account. Such security protocols, though beneficial, contribute to the user’s inability to open their emails.

  • Phishing Attacks and Data Breaches

    Compromised passwords often result from phishing attacks or data breaches. In phishing attacks, users are tricked into revealing their passwords to fraudulent websites or emails. Data breaches involve the theft of password databases from compromised websites or services. If a user’s email password is exposed in a data breach or through a phishing scam, unauthorized parties can use it to access the email account and change the password, leading to access denial for the legitimate user. These types of attacks contribute to a significant percentage of “why can’t i open my emails” cases.

  • Two-Factor Authentication Bypass

    While two-factor authentication (2FA) adds an extra layer of security, sophisticated attackers may attempt to bypass it. Even with 2FA enabled, a compromised password can allow an attacker to initiate account recovery processes. If the attacker can successfully intercept or manipulate the recovery process, they can change the password, thereby denying access to the legitimate user. Though 2FA provides increased security, its bypass underscores the persistent risk associated with compromised passwords in the context of email access.

In conclusion, a compromised password is a significant factor contributing to “why can’t i open my emails”. Whether through unauthorized account access, security protocol triggers, phishing attacks, data breaches, or 2FA bypass, the unauthorized disclosure or theft of login credentials directly leads to the user’s inability to access their electronic correspondence. Secure password management and proactive monitoring for security breaches are essential measures to mitigate this risk.

8. Corrupted email data

Corrupted email data serves as a direct impediment to accessing electronic mail, manifesting as an inability to open, view, or properly interpret email messages. This corruption, which can occur at various stages of email processing, renders the data unreadable or unusable by the email client, subsequently leading to access denial. The occurrence of data corruption directly relates to the problem of “why can’t i open my emails” by rendering the email data inaccessible to the end-user. For example, a partially downloaded email due to network interruption may contain incomplete or erroneous data, preventing the email client from rendering its content correctly. Similarly, file system errors or storage device malfunctions can lead to corruption of stored email messages, causing similar access failures. The importance of this connection lies in understanding that corrupted data represents a fundamental barrier to accessing electronic correspondence and that addressing data integrity issues is a necessary step in resolving email access problems.

Further analysis reveals that email data corruption can arise from diverse sources, including software bugs, hardware failures, and malware infections. A faulty email client or server software can introduce errors during the encoding or decoding of email messages, leading to data corruption. Disk errors or storage device malfunctions can physically damage the files containing email data, rendering them unreadable. Malware infections can deliberately corrupt email data, either to disrupt system operations or to conceal malicious payloads. In each of these scenarios, the result is the same: email data is rendered inaccessible, preventing the user from opening or viewing the message. Practical applications of this understanding involve employing data recovery tools to attempt to salvage corrupted email data and implementing data redundancy measures, such as backups, to mitigate the risk of data loss due to corruption. Regular disk checks and antivirus scans also aid in preventing data corruption caused by hardware failures or malware infections, respectively.

In conclusion, corrupted email data presents a clear and significant cause of the problem “why can’t i open my emails”. The issue arises from various factors, including software bugs, hardware failures, and malware infections, all of which can render email messages inaccessible. The ability to recognize and address data corruption is paramount in effectively troubleshooting email access problems. Implementing data recovery tools, employing data redundancy measures, and conducting regular system maintenance are crucial steps in preventing data corruption and ensuring the continued accessibility of electronic correspondence. Addressing these challenges strengthens the overall reliability and usability of email systems.

Tips for Addressing “Why Can’t I Open My Emails”

When encountering persistent difficulties accessing electronic mail, a structured approach to troubleshooting is essential. The following guidelines provide a framework for diagnosing and resolving common access issues.

Tip 1: Verify Network Connectivity. Ensure a stable and active internet connection. Test connectivity by browsing the web or using network diagnostic tools. Intermittent or absent network access is a primary impediment to accessing electronic mail.

Tip 2: Review Account Settings. Scrutinize electronic mail account settings, including username, password, and server addresses (IMAP/POP3/SMTP). Confirm that these settings are accurate and consistent with the electronic mail provider’s requirements. Typographical errors are common causes of access failure.

Tip 3: Assess Server Status. Check the electronic mail provider’s service status page or contact support to ascertain whether the server is experiencing downtime or undergoing maintenance. Electronic mail access is impossible when the server is unavailable.

Tip 4: Ensure Software Compatibility. Verify that the electronic mail client and the server meet the minimum software version requirements. Upgrade the software to compatible versions to mitigate potential incompatibility issues.

Tip 5: Monitor Storage Capacity. Assess the electronic mail account’s storage capacity. Delete unnecessary messages or archive older electronic mail to free up space, enabling receipt of new messages. Local storage limitations should also be addressed.

Tip 6: Evaluate Security Software Settings. Review security software settings, such as antivirus programs and firewalls, to ensure that electronic mail traffic is not being blocked inadvertently. Adjust security software configurations to permit legitimate electronic mail communication.

Tip 7: Perform Malware Scans. Conduct routine malware scans using reputable antivirus software to identify and eliminate potential infections. Malware can corrupt electronic mail data or compromise access credentials.

By systematically addressing these common causes, the likelihood of resolving access issues is significantly increased. A proactive approach to electronic mail maintenance ensures reliable and consistent communication.
